Number of Successful BTS Loopback Attempts after the Handover during the BSC Loopback

Measurement Counter

R3831b:CELL_LOCALSWITCH_BSCLOOP_HO_BTSLOOP_SUCCESS

Description

A handover is initiated in the stable BSC loopback state (BSC loopback is successful and the calling and called MSs are in loopback state). After the handover, the BTS loopback procedure is restarted. The BSC determines the loopback start conditions, performs BSC local switch call detection, sends a BTS loopback start request message, adjusts the speech versions of the calling and called MSs, and performs loopback on the BTS side. If all these actions are successful, the BTS loopback is successful.

This measurement provides the number of successful BTS loopback attempts after the handover during the BSC loopback.

Measurement Point

A handover is performed in the stable BSC loopback state. After the handover, the BSC selects the BSS local switch policy, determines the local switch start conditions, and performs local switch call detection. If all the local switch conditions are met, the BTS local loopback procedure is started. Within the BSC, the call processing module initiating loopback start at one end sends a loopback request message to the call processing module at the peer end. The call processing module at the peer end sends a BTS loopback request message to the BTS. If the BTS loopback is successful, the BTS responds to the call processing module with a BTS loopback acknowledgement message (loopback success). Then, the call processing module at the peer end returns the call processing module at the TX end a loopback acknowledgement message (loopback success). In this case, this counter is measured in the cell where the loopback start is initiated.
